Selling a property in the UK can be both exciting and challenging. For many property owners, understanding the current interest rates and house prices is crucial when determining the best time to sell. Interest rates play a significant role in the property market. When interest rates are low, it generally means that borrowing money is more affordable. This can encourage potential buyers to take out mortgages and invest in properties, ultimately driving up house prices. On the other hand, high-interest rates may deter buyers, leading to a slower market and potentially lower prices. In recent years, the Bank of England has maintained historically low-interest rates to stimulate economic growth. This has created a favourable environment for property sellers, as low rates make it easier for buyers to secure financing. When it comes to house prices in the UK, London has always been a prime location for property investment. However, the market can vary significantly from one area to another. If you are looking to sell your property in London, consider focusing on areas that have shown resilience in terms of house price growth. Neighbourhoods with high demand and limited supply are more likely to yield a profitable sale.
